Description
Job Opportunity: RRT - Respiratory Therapy
Location: Miami, Florida
Employment Type: Travel Contract
Contract Length: 13 weeks
Specialty
- Registered Respiratory Therapist (RRT)
- Required Years of Experience: 2 years of current acute care hospital RRT experience (highest requirement)
- NICU/PICU experience required
- Advanced skills needed: Current NICU/PICU experience
Certifications & Licenses
- Respiratory Therapist (RT) License/Certification required
- Required Certifications: ACLS, BLS, NRP, PALS
Unit Information
- Unit: Respiratory - NICU/PICU
- Level 3 NICU, Level 1 adult and pediatric trauma center, Certified Comprehensive Stroke Center
- Equipment used: High Flow Devices, 3100A, Bunnell, Servo’s, continuous nebulizers, Nitric Oxide, Heliox, regular nebulizers
- Documentation system: Meditech (preferred experience)
- Floating policy: May provide coverage for adult floors (nebulizer therapy, BIPAP, CPT, etc.)
Skills & Requirements
- Must have: BLS, NRP, PALS certifications
- Preferred: Previous Meditech experience
- Procedures: Provide treatment, care, and evaluation for patients with respiratory diseases using advanced technologies and medication delivery
- Personality fit: Team player, critical thinker, patient care focused, adaptable to fast-paced and changing environments
- Multidisciplinary and collaborative approach to patient care
Dress Code
- Required uniform color: Light Gray (Silver)

About Miami, FL
As a Travel Respiratory Therapist in Miami, FL here's what you should know:- Miami's cost of living is higher than the national average, especially in terms of housing and transportation.
- Wages may not always match up with the higher cost of living.
- Average summer highs range from 87°F to 90°F, while winter lows range from 59°F to 65°F.
- Short term rentals are available in Miami, but they may be in high demand, especially during peak tourist seasons.
- Miami is not very car-friendly due to heavy traffic congestion, but public transportation options like buses and the Metrorail are available.
- Miami is a diverse city with a large Hispanic population.
- The age range is varied, with a significant number of retirees.
- Common health issues may include skin-related conditions due to the sunny climate.
- Miami has a large population of travel nurses due to its numerous healthcare facilities.
- Miami offers a vibrant restaurant scene with a focus on Cuban and Latin cuisine.
- The city is a hub for art and music, with attractions like the Pérez Art Museum Miami and the Wynwood Walls.
- Sports enthusiasts can enjoy water activities, and the city is surrounded by beautiful outdoor spaces for hiking and beach activities.
